Malout, July 19

Depressed due to a matrimonial dispute, a 32-year-old man named Ajaypal Singh, a resident of Mohalla Kalgidhar School, allegedly committed suicide by consuming some poisonous substance here on Wednesday. The police have booked four members from his in-laws family. They are yet to be arrested.

Gurnam Singh, father of the deceased, alleged, “My son had got married about eight years ago to a girl from Kothe Killianwali. However, six months ago, my daughter-in-law returned to her parents’ house. A few days ago, we came to know that she was living with some other man. It drove my son to take this extreme step.”

He had a five-year-old daughter. The police have booked deceased’s wife Deepinder Kaur, her mother Virpal Kaur, brother Jaspreet Singh and Bharpoor Singh. — TNS
